What Is Pneumonia?

Pneumonia is a respiratory condition involving inflammation of the lungs, often resulting in symptoms that can affect daily activities. It is caused by infections from bacteria, viruses, or other microorganisms, and the severity can vary depending on age and general health. Who Is at Risk? Age and Vulnerability

Pneumonia can affect anyone, but certain age groups are more commonly impacted. Infants, young children, and older adults often experience higher vulnerability due to developing or weakened immune systems. Adults with chronic conditions may also need to be aware of factors that can increase susceptibility.

Common Symptoms to Be Aware Of

Recognising early signs of pneumonia is important for general awareness. Symptoms can include coughing, fatigue, fever, and shortness of breath. While it is critical to seek professional medical advice if symptoms appear, understanding these general indicators can help Australians be more informed about their health and wellbeing.

Understanding HIV

HIV (Human Immunodeficiency Virus) affects the immune system. While this guide is purely informational, understanding basic facts is important for awareness. HIV can be transmitted through blood, sexual contact, or from mother to child during childbirth.
